About the Role
We are looking for an experienced and motivated individual to join our Product team as a Senior Product Manager specializing in the Culinary domain.
In this role, you will lead the development of Product Information Management (PIM) and Menu Management Systems—critical components of our autonomous kitchen ecosystem. These systems manage ingredients, recipes, and menu configurations, enabling scalable, efficient, and delightful culinary experiences.
Reporting to the Head of Product, you will own the full product lifecycle, champion cross-functional collaboration, and develop solutions that enhance culinary workflows, ensure seamless recipe execution, and empower partners to customize menus for diverse contexts.
This is a high-impact role where your contributions will directly shape the software powering the next generation of food service.
